White Sand Imperial IPA

White Sand is one of the "twin" Imperial IPAs from Strand Brewing Co. It pours a light copper color with a lacy head. The malts dominate this beer and it has a British feel to it, which is surprising for a Southern California Imperial IPA. When compared to the Black Sand, the flavors are a little spicier with more floral and piney hop notes. There's still an abundance of caramel malt, and a pretty bitter finish. This is a nice, complex beer, but similar to the Black Sand except for a lighter color and a more spicy hop profile.
